|
Please note that this page does not hosts or makes available any of the listed filenames. You
cannot download any of those files from here.
|
| 1.1 GitHub - Task Management Front-end.html |
120B |
| 1.1 project-overview-edited.mp4 |
50.24MB |
| 1. Front-end Application Set-up (Development Mode).mp4 |
26.98MB |
| 1. Front-end Application Set-up (Development Mode).srt |
7.90KB |
| 1. GraphQL + MongoDB Section Introduction.mp4 |
20.97MB |
| 1. GraphQL + MongoDB Section Introduction.srt |
1.70KB |
| 1. HTTPS - Secure Communication.html |
1.35KB |
| 1. Installing PostgreSQL and pgAdmin.html |
946B |
| 1. Introduction to Logging.mp4 |
13.77MB |
| 1. Introduction to Logging.srt |
3.84KB |
| 1. Introduction to NestJS Pipes.mp4 |
43.34MB |
| 1. Introduction to NestJS Pipes.srt |
6.19KB |
| 1. Project Overview Task Management Application.mp4 |
31.50MB |
| 1. Project Overview Task Management Application.srt |
8.12KB |
| 1. Setting up AuthModule, User Entity and UserRepository.mp4 |
32.60MB |
| 1. Setting up AuthModule, User Entity and UserRepository.srt |
6.01KB |
| 1. Signing up to Amazon Web Services and signing up.html |
1.89KB |
| 1. Tasks and Users - Database Relation.mp4 |
32.00MB |
| 1. Tasks and Users - Database Relation.srt |
4.67KB |
| 1. Unit Testing Crash Course - Basics.mp4 |
19.35MB |
| 1. Unit Testing Crash Course - Basics.srt |
3.96KB |
| 1. Welcome to the course!.mp4 |
4.20MB |
| 1. Welcome to the course!.srt |
1.73KB |
| 1. Windows Environment Variables.html |
685B |
| 10. Defining a Task Model.mp4 |
23.41MB |
| 10. Defining a Task Model.srt |
5.94KB |
| 10. Defining the Lesson GraphQL Type.mp4 |
16.60MB |
| 10. Defining the Lesson GraphQL Type.srt |
3.67KB |
| 10. Persistence Creating a Task.mp4 |
53.93MB |
| 10. Persistence Creating a Task.srt |
7.46KB |
| 10. Setting up the JWT Strategy for Authorization.mp4 |
56.97MB |
| 10. Setting up the JWT Strategy for Authorization.srt |
8.80KB |
| 10. Source Code - Deployment.html |
415B |
| 10. Testing JwtStrategy.mp4 |
63.75MB |
| 10. Testing JwtStrategy.srt |
6.81KB |
| 11.1 TypeORM Repisotry.delete().html |
148B |
| 11.2 TypeORM Repository.remove().html |
148B |
| 11. Challenge Delete Task Persistence.mp4 |
10.93MB |
| 11. Challenge Delete Task Persistence.srt |
2.32KB |
| 11. Creating the Lesson Resolver.mp4 |
21.82MB |
| 11. Creating the Lesson Resolver.srt |
5.17KB |
| 11. IMPORTANT GetUser Decorator.html |
862B |
| 11. NOTE Imprting UUID in the next lecture.html |
240B |
| 11. Testing Final Words.html |
699B |
| 12.1 TypeORM Repository.delete().html |
148B |
| 12.2 TypeORM Repository.remove().html |
148B |
| 12. Custom @GetUser() Decorator.mp4 |
23.70MB |
| 12. Custom @GetUser() Decorator.srt |
3.46KB |
| 12. Feature Creating a Task (Part 1 Service).mp4 |
34.00MB |
| 12. Feature Creating a Task (Part 1 Service).srt |
6.64KB |
| 12. Solution Delete Task Persistence.mp4 |
46.02MB |
| 12. Solution Delete Task Persistence.srt |
9.29KB |
| 12. Source Code - Testing.html |
425B |
| 12. Using the GraphQL Playground.mp4 |
13.37MB |
| 12. Using the GraphQL Playground.srt |
5.33KB |
| 13. Feature Creating a Task (Part 2 Controller).mp4 |
42.57MB |
| 13. Feature Creating a Task (Part 2 Controller).srt |
6.44KB |
| 13. Guarding the Tasks Routes (TasksController).mp4 |
16.55MB |
| 13. Guarding the Tasks Routes (TasksController).srt |
3.09KB |
| 13. Persistence TypeORM, MongoDB and our Lesson Entity.mp4 |
38.27MB |
| 13. Persistence TypeORM, MongoDB and our Lesson Entity.srt |
6.76KB |
| 13. Persistence Updating Task Status.mp4 |
27.57MB |
| 13. Persistence Updating Task Status.srt |
4.02KB |
| 14. IMPORTANT Before Persistence of Getting Tasks.mp4 |
27.35MB |
| 14. IMPORTANT Before Persistence of Getting Tasks.srt |
4.02KB |
| 14. Introduction to Data Transfer Objects (DTOs).mp4 |
56.25MB |
| 14. Introduction to Data Transfer Objects (DTOs).srt |
8.38KB |
| 14. LessonService and createLesson method.mp4 |
59.81MB |
| 14. LessonService and createLesson method.srt |
8.86KB |
| 14. Summary Quiz.html |
130B |
| 15.1 TypeORM Query Builder.html |
136B |
| 15. Create Lesson GraphQL Mutation.mp4 |
26.81MB |
| 15. Create Lesson GraphQL Mutation.srt |
5.07KB |
| 15. Creating a CreateTaskDto.mp4 |
40.30MB |
| 15. Creating a CreateTaskDto.srt |
5.62KB |
| 15. Persistence Getting Tasks (with or without filters).mp4 |
67.67MB |
| 15. Persistence Getting Tasks (with or without filters).srt |
11.27KB |
| 16. Feature Getting a Task by ID.mp4 |
32.28MB |
| 16. Feature Getting a Task by ID.srt |
4.97KB |
| 16. getLesson GraphQL Query with MongoDB.mp4 |
24.74MB |
| 16. getLesson GraphQL Query with MongoDB.srt |
3.78KB |
| 16. Summary Quiz.html |
130B |
| 17. Challenge Deleting a Task.mp4 |
5.11MB |
| 17. Challenge Deleting a Task.srt |
1.00KB |
| 17. Source Code - Data Persistence.html |
488B |
| 17. Validation Create Lesson Input.mp4 |
51.40MB |
| 17. Validation Create Lesson Input.srt |
7.70KB |
| 18. Challenge Get All Lessons GraphQL Query.mp4 |
25.47MB |
| 18. Challenge Get All Lessons GraphQL Query.srt |
4.69KB |
| 18. Solution Deleting a Task.mp4 |
36.39MB |
| 18. Solution Deleting a Task.srt |
6.69KB |
| 19. Challenge Updating a Task's Status.mp4 |
9.97MB |
| 19. Challenge Updating a Task's Status.srt |
1.54KB |
| 19. Creating the Student Module.mp4 |
8.12MB |
| 19. Creating the Student Module.srt |
1.95KB |
| 2.1 AWS S3 Bucket Policy.html |
142B |
| 2.1 class-validator GitHub repository.html |
127B |
| 2.1 feature-sign-up.mp4 |
108.39MB |
| 2.1 NestJS Documentation - Logger.html |
102B |
| 2.1 pgAdmin Download.html |
94B |
| 2.2 index.html |
263B |
| 2. Amazon S3 Setting up a Bucket (Front-end Hosting).mp4 |
31.61MB |
| 2. Amazon S3 Setting up a Bucket (Front-end Hosting).srt |
6.32KB |
| 2. Applying logging in our application.mp4 |
104.37MB |
| 2. Applying logging in our application.srt |
13.96KB |
| 2. Authorization Creating a Task For User.mp4 |
32.57MB |
| 2. Authorization Creating a Task For User.srt |
4.58KB |
| 2. Creating a project via the CLI and an introduction to a NestJS project structure.mp4 |
35.70MB |
| 2. Creating a project via the CLI and an introduction to a NestJS project structure.srt |
8.13KB |
| 2. Feature Sign Up.mp4 |
56.04MB |
| 2. Feature Sign Up.srt |
10.32KB |
| 2. Introduction to Configuration.mp4 |
10.56MB |
| 2. Introduction to Configuration.srt |
1.87KB |
| 2. Proceeding with NestJS & Back-end Development.html |
744B |
| 2. Project Overview School Management.mp4 |
17.99MB |
| 2. Project Overview School Management.srt |
3.80KB |
| 2. Thank you + Future Content.mp4 |
34.99MB |
| 2. Thank you + Future Content.srt |
2.51KB |
| 2. Unit Testing Crash Course - First Tests.mp4 |
122.02MB |
| 2. Unit Testing Crash Course - First Tests.srt |
17.19KB |
| 2. Using pgAdmin to create a Database.mp4 |
9.04MB |
| 2. Using pgAdmin to create a Database.srt |
2.44KB |
| 2. ValidationPipe Creating a Task.mp4 |
27.68MB |
| 2. ValidationPipe Creating a Task.srt |
4.30KB |
| 20. Challenge Defining the Student Entity.mp4 |
20.04MB |
| 20. Challenge Defining the Student Entity.srt |
2.96KB |
| 20. Solution Updating a Task's Status.mp4 |
32.73MB |
| 20. Solution Updating a Task's Status.srt |
5.58KB |
| 21. Challenge Create Student Mutation.mp4 |
73.83MB |
| 21. Challenge Create Student Mutation.srt |
9.15KB |
| 21. Feature Searching and Filtering Tasks.mp4 |
82.95MB |
| 21. Feature Searching and Filtering Tasks.srt |
10.50KB |
| 22. Challenge Get All Students GraphQL Query.mp4 |
17.62MB |
| 22. Challenge Get All Students GraphQL Query.srt |
2.63KB |
| 22. Summary Quiz.html |
130B |
| 23. Challenge Get Student by ID Query.mp4 |
20.33MB |
| 23. Challenge Get Student by ID Query.srt |
2.49KB |
| 23. NEW COURSE + DISCOUNT COUPON.html |
489B |
| 24. Assign Students To Lesson GraphQL Mutation.mp4 |
73.36MB |
| 24. Assign Students To Lesson GraphQL Mutation.srt |
10.45KB |
| 25. Improvement Assign Students Upon Lesson Creation.mp4 |
26.01MB |
| 25. Improvement Assign Students Upon Lesson Creation.srt |
2.84KB |
| 26. Resolve students Field in Lesson.mp4 |
67.46MB |
| 26. Resolve students Field in Lesson.srt |
8.99KB |
| 27. Additional Resources GraphQL.html |
502B |
| 3.1 Regular Expression - Wikipedia.html |
109B |
| 3.2 GitHub Gist - Regular Expression used in this lecture.html |
133B |
| 3. Authorization Getting Tasks For User.mp4 |
37.71MB |
| 3. Authorization Getting Tasks For User.srt |
6.71KB |
| 3. Configuration Management Set-up.mp4 |
32.08MB |
| 3. Configuration Management Set-up.srt |
6.98KB |
| 3. Domain Names for AWS Applications.html |
999B |
| 3. Enabling CORS from the S3 Front-end Application.mp4 |
18.24MB |
| 3. Enabling CORS from the S3 Front-end Application.srt |
4.23KB |
| 3. Error Handling Getting a non-existing Task.mp4 |
21.46MB |
| 3. Error Handling Getting a non-existing Task.srt |
3.78KB |
| 3. Introduction to NestJS Modules.mp4 |
19.11MB |
| 3. Introduction to NestJS Modules.srt |
2.91KB |
| 3. Introduction to Object Relational Mapping and TypeORM.mp4 |
17.72MB |
| 3. Introduction to Object Relational Mapping and TypeORM.srt |
4.25KB |
| 3. MongoDB Installation.html |
1.60KB |
| 3. Testing TasksService - Part 1 - getTasks.mp4 |
97.54MB |
| 3. Testing TasksService - Part 1 - getTasks.srt |
13.85KB |
| 3. Validation AuthCredentialsDto, password strength.mp4 |
25.32MB |
| 3. Validation AuthCredentialsDto, password strength.srt |
5.81KB |
| 3. What is NestJS.mp4 |
12.88MB |
| 3. What is NestJS.srt |
2.83KB |
| 4.1 Rainbow table - Wikipedia.html |
104B |
| 4.2 Salt (cryptography) - Wikipedia.html |
110B |
| 4. Applying Configuration - Codebase (Part 1).mp4 |
69.82MB |
| 4. Applying Configuration - Codebase (Part 1).srt |
9.55KB |
| 4. Authorization Getting a User's Task.mp4 |
21.25MB |
| 4. Authorization Getting a User's Task.srt |
3.92KB |
| 4. Creating a Tasks Module.mp4 |
13.25MB |
| 4. Creating a Tasks Module.srt |
3.58KB |
| 4. Elastic Beanstalk CLI.html |
696B |
| 4. Error Handling Deleting a non-existing Task.mp4 |
12.82MB |
| 4. Error Handling Deleting a non-existing Task.srt |
2.27KB |
| 4. Error Handling Duplicate Usernames.mp4 |
47.24MB |
| 4. Error Handling Duplicate Usernames.srt |
7.10KB |
| 4. IMPORTANT bcryptjs NPM package.html |
976B |
| 4. IMPORTANT TypeORM Entities Configuration.html |
454B |
| 4. Installing Node.js and NPM.html |
458B |
| 4. Robo 3T - Connecting to the MongoDB Database.mp4 |
4.85MB |
| 4. Robo 3T - Connecting to the MongoDB Database.srt |
1.63KB |
| 4. Testing TasksService - Part 2 - getTaskById.mp4 |
76.29MB |
| 4. Testing TasksService - Part 2 - getTaskById.srt |
8.16KB |
| 5. (Challenge) Testing TasksService - Part 3 - createTask.mp4 |
52.22MB |
| 5. (Challenge) Testing TasksService - Part 3 - createTask.srt |
6.24KB |
| 5. Authorization Updating a User's Task Status.mp4 |
11.57MB |
| 5. Authorization Updating a User's Task Status.srt |
1.84KB |
| 5. Connecting NestJS to a database using TypeORM.mp4 |
30.33MB |
| 5. Connecting NestJS to a database using TypeORM.srt |
6.67KB |
| 5. Custom Pipe Validating the Task Status.mp4 |
52.44MB |
| 5. Custom Pipe Validating the Task Status.srt |
7.46KB |
| 5. Ensure NestJS 7 Installation.mp4 |
1.70MB |
| 5. Ensure NestJS 7 Installation.srt |
1.21KB |
| 5. Installing the NestJS CLI.mp4 |
9.72MB |
| 5. Installing the NestJS CLI.srt |
2.86KB |
| 5. Introduction to NestJS Controllers.mp4 |
27.00MB |
| 5. Introduction to NestJS Controllers.srt |
4.94KB |
| 5. Security Hashing Passwords & Using Salts.mp4 |
76.93MB |
| 5. Security Hashing Passwords & Using Salts.srt |
10.80KB |
| 5. Source Code - Configuration.html |
447B |
| 5. TIP Before Deploying to Production.html |
856B |
| 6.1 pre-prod-packagejson-changes.mp4 |
36.99MB |
| 6.1 TypeORM Entities.html |
124B |
| 6. Authorization Deleting a User's Task.mp4 |
19.53MB |
| 6. Authorization Deleting a User's Task.srt |
2.90KB |
| 6. Creating a Task Entity.mp4 |
9.17MB |
| 6. Creating a Task Entity.srt |
2.04KB |
| 6. Creating a Tasks Controller.mp4 |
15.49MB |
| 6. Creating a Tasks Controller.srt |
4.26KB |
| 6. Feature Validating Password - Sign In.mp4 |
68.50MB |
| 6. Feature Validating Password - Sign In.srt |
9.88KB |
| 6. Installing Postman.html |
479B |
| 6. Pre-production package.json Adjustments.mp4 |
17.66MB |
| 6. Pre-production package.json Adjustments.srt |
2.00KB |
| 6. Project setup.mp4 |
9.86MB |
| 6. Project setup.srt |
3.09KB |
| 6. Testing TasksService - Part 4 - deleteTask.mp4 |
51.18MB |
| 6. Testing TasksService - Part 4 - deleteTask.srt |
4.55KB |
| 6. ValidationPipe Task Filtering and Search.mp4 |
24.23MB |
| 6. ValidationPipe Task Filtering and Search.srt |
4.42KB |
| 7. (Challenge) Testing TasksService - Part 5 - updateTaskStatus.mp4 |
51.88MB |
| 7. (Challenge) Testing TasksService - Part 5 - updateTaskStatus.srt |
6.69KB |
| 7. (Optional) Installing Visual Studio Code.html |
772B |
| 7.1 TypeORM Repository Documentation.html |
141B |
| 7.2 TypeORM Custom Repository.html |
133B |
| 7. Creating a Task Repository.mp4 |
17.09MB |
| 7. Creating a Task Repository.srt |
4.37KB |
| 7. IMPORTANT! GraphQL installation version.html |
657B |
| 7. IMPORTANT Change in TypeORM Configuration.html |
946B |
| 7. Introduction to JSON Web Tokens (JWT).mp4 |
34.63MB |
| 7. Introduction to JSON Web Tokens (JWT).srt |
6.20KB |
| 7. Introduction to NestJS Providers and Services.mp4 |
24.19MB |
| 7. Introduction to NestJS Providers and Services.srt |
3.59KB |
| 7. Source Code - Authentication & Authorization.html |
464B |
| 7. Summary Quiz.html |
130B |
| 8.1 @nestjspassport - GitHub.html |
95B |
| 8.2 @nestjsjwt - GitHub.html |
90B |
| 8. Creating a Tasks Service.mp4 |
15.65MB |
| 8. Creating a Tasks Service.srt |
4.03KB |
| 8. Deploying NestJS to Elastic Beanstalk.mp4 |
54.83MB |
| 8. Deploying NestJS to Elastic Beanstalk.srt |
9.93KB |
| 8. Installing GraphQL Dependencies.mp4 |
16.27MB |
| 8. Installing GraphQL Dependencies.srt |
3.86KB |
| 8. Preparation for Task Service Refactoring.mp4 |
24.59MB |
| 8. Preparation for Task Service Refactoring.srt |
3.38KB |
| 8. Setting up the JWT Module and Passport.js.mp4 |
30.04MB |
| 8. Setting up the JWT Module and Passport.js.srt |
4.46KB |
| 8. Source Code - Validation and Error Handling.html |
457B |
| 8. Testing UserRepository.mp4 |
162.49MB |
| 8. Testing UserRepository.srt |
17.59KB |
| 9.1 TypeORM findOne.html |
149B |
| 9. Creating the Lesson Module.mp4 |
7.97MB |
| 9. Creating the Lesson Module.srt |
1.71KB |
| 9. Feature Getting all Tasks.mp4 |
26.24MB |
| 9. Feature Getting all Tasks.srt |
6.33KB |
| 9. Persistence Getting a Task by ID.mp4 |
48.81MB |
| 9. Persistence Getting a Task by ID.srt |
8.00KB |
| 9. Signing a JWT Token Upon Authentication.mp4 |
33.10MB |
| 9. Signing a JWT Token Upon Authentication.srt |
5.75KB |
| 9. Testing User Entity.mp4 |
53.01MB |
| 9. Testing User Entity.srt |
6.85KB |
| 9. Uploading the Front-end App to S3.mp4 |
19.84MB |
| 9. Uploading the Front-end App to S3.srt |
3.64KB |